Postal code resolution for ~60 countries via Zippopotam.us (GeoNames data, CC BY 4.0). Forward: ?country=us&code=90210 -> place names, state, lat/lon. Reverse: ?country=us&state=ca&city=beverly hills -> matching postal codes with coordinates. Unknown codes return found=false (an explicit validation verdict). Cached 30 days.
